Polymer clay is a great medium for creating faux stones and one of those stone is faux turquoise. Real turquoise comes in many different variations. Almost too many to count and so this leaves endless variations for us polymer clayers to play around with. In this tutorial I’ll be showing faux black veined turquoise. I show a few examples at the end of the tutorial of the other variations I’ve come up with too.
